What is Verizon Managed Certificate Services?

In the world of business security, placing a high emphasis on safety is essential for mitigating potential threats. It’s important to note that not every device is trustworthy, and the same applies to the individuals accessing your network. By implementing Managed Certificate Services (MCS), organizations can quickly authenticate users while ensuring the protection of vital data across their infrastructure, devices, and applications through a centralized and dependable source of digital certificates. With our broad IP network that caters to a multitude of Fortune 1000 companies, we understand the pressing demand for robust security protocols in the current digital environment. MCS allows you to strike an ideal balance between robust security and seamless operational effectiveness. Functioning as an automated authentication solution for your certificate chain, MCS provides thorough lifecycle management for all digital credentials within corporate entities, users, applications, services, devices, and machines across your organization. Furthermore, MCS not only enhances your security framework but also simplifies the oversight of your digital resources, ultimately promoting a more secure and efficient operational landscape. This dual advantage of fortified security and streamlined management makes MCS an invaluable asset for modern businesses.

What is AWS Certificate Manager?

AWS Certificate Manager streamlines the process of obtaining, overseeing, and deploying SSL/TLS certificates, whether they are public or private, which are vital for ensuring secure communications within AWS services and among internal systems. These certificates are essential for protecting online exchanges and authenticating websites found on the Internet, in addition to securing private network communications. By leveraging AWS Certificate Manager, users can alleviate the burdensome responsibilities tied to acquiring, uploading, and renewing SSL/TLS certificates. Industry standards recognize the SSL and TLS protocols for their effectiveness in encrypting data shared over networks and validating the identities of online websites. The implementation of SSL/TLS safeguards sensitive data during transmission, while certificates confirm website identities, facilitating secure connections between users' browsers, applications, and the web services they interact with. This service ultimately not only strengthens security but also improves the efficiency of managing certificates across multiple platforms. Additionally, it empowers organizations to focus on their core operations without being bogged down by the complexities of certificate management.
